2004 Audi A3 vs. 1998 Chevrolet Astro
To start off, 2004 Audi A3 is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1998 Chevrolet Astro.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1998 Chevrolet Astro would be higher. At 4,293 cc (6 cylinders), 1998 Chevrolet Astro is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Audi A3 (252 HP @ 6300 RPM) has 69 more horse power than 1998 Chevrolet Astro. (183 HP @ 4400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2004 Audi A3 should accelerate faster than 1998 Chevrolet Astro.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1998 Chevrolet Astro weights approximately 330 kg more than 2004 Audi A3.
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1998 Chevrolet Astro (338 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 18 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Audi A3. (320 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 1998 Chevrolet Astro will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Audi A3. 2004 Audi A3 has automatic transmission and 1998 Chevrolet Astro has manual transmission. 1998 Chevrolet Astro will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2004 Audi A3 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
